Moya, Nishikori pull out of U.S. Open with injuries
WHITE PLAINS, N.Y. (AP)—The U.S. Tennis Association says former No. 1 Carlos Moya of Spain is pulling out of the U.S. Open because of a foot injury.
The 1998 French Open champion has been sidelined most of this season; his ranking recently slipped out of the top 100. Kei Nishikori of Japan was atop the alternates list for the year’s last Grand Slam tournament, but he withdrew due to an injury, too.
The two departures mean that 106th-ranked Nicolas Lapentti of Ecuador moves into the tournament’s main draw.
The U.S. Open begins Aug. 31.

Seeding Battle
The race to the number two seeding at the US Open could be decided tomorrow in Cincinnati.
If Murray def. Federer he is guaranteed number two seeding.
If Nadal def Federer (in the final) he is guaranteed number two seeding.
It would feel so weird if Federer and Nadal end up on the same half of the draw at the US Open. Nevertheless, whoever (out of Federer, Murray, Nadal and Djokovic) ends up with del Potro in their quarter could consider themselves very unlucky. Same goes for Roddick, but to a lessor extent.
